    Default Can a Gun Owner Move Into a Home With a Felon in Residence

    A man in Florida is dating a woman who rents an apartment with a roommate. He wants to move in with her. However, her roommate is on felony probation, and the man is a gun owner. Can he legally bring his guns into the apartment if he moves in? He would keep them in a gun safe in his girlfriend's bedroom.

    Default Re: Can a Gun Owner Move Into a Home With a Felon in Residence

    The man can take his guns into the new residence without worrying about charges against him, because he's not the person on probation.

    The roommate is the one who could get into legal trouble for living in a home where firearms are present. The roommate should thus clear any such plan with his probation officer before any guns come into the apartment.
